Of course! Always happy to help! I did personally, everybody’s body chemistry is a little different so don’t be afraid to try both and see what works better for you. But if we’re talking science, scientifically jojoba oil is the closest oil there is to natural sebum (skin oil) so it’s the best one I’ve found that actually helps not only dislodge the pearls but make them smaller as well, which then makes them easier to get out.

I always recommend people try this before getting the surgical procedure, the pearls are just built up & hardened oil and we don’t want to do surgery in that area unless you’ve tried everything and it’s a last & final resort. (For anyone who may be reading)

[–]Hang-In-There-Friend[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Hi friend! Firstly great work!!! That’s amazing you got so much progress! I find that slow and steady is the best way to go. Try not to work on it more than 10 minutes, don’t ever work on it without oil or lubrication you risk tears. Be patient, if you can do an oil bath once a day and stretch the labia, that area will release, I’m betting some of the muscle and fascia is tight and that may be why it’s trapped there. I’ve had the same thing happen. What I would recommend: Sitz bath with oil. Stretching. Slowly. Massaging the area and around the are in small circular motions. No more than 10 minutes a day. Use the jojoba oil each time, be generous with it, we want it to get in all the nooks and crannies to loosen everything up and then slowly massage it in the direction it looks like it’ll come out. If the hood is not as tight up top massage it upwards into that looser area. After a few weeks you should hopefully see success! It may even happen sooner than that. Hang in there friend.
